Saxophonist Ethan Miller hails from Buffalo, New York, and is quickly rising as one of our generation’s most sought after saxophone players. In addition to performing in Duende, he is also a member of the Cleveland Saxophone Quartet, Trio Diverso, and the Ethan Miller Jazztet. ClevelandClassical.com hails guitarist Krystin O’Mara as “someone to watch” for having “wonderful technique as well as keen musical sensibilities.” In addition to recording with Ethan Miller, in the last few years she has appeared on several concert series across North America. “Travel Notebook,” is a concept album which explores music which originated in different cultures and regions as experienced by the composers who wrote these pieces. The selections chosen for this release align with the duo’s initiative of presenting a diverse selection of material which is drawn from global musical traditions.
